"There are two issues that can affect the 1095-A. These will help to correct them.

 To Delete a form:

  1. On the menu bar on the left that shows.

    1. My Info

    2. Federal

    3. State

    4. Review

    5. File

  2. Select Tax Tools

  3. On the drop-down select Tools

  4. On the Pop-Up menu select Delete a Form

  5. This will give you all of the forms in your return

  6. Scroll down to the form you want to delete

  7. Select the Form

  8. Click on Delete.

 

Always use extreme caution when deleting from your tax return.  There could be unintended consequences.

 

The workaround is to enter $1 for the 1095-A.  This will not affect anything on your return but having the form there may get the IRS to accept your return. 

To do this take the following steps: 

  1. Click Deductions and Credits

  2. Scroll down to Medical and Click Show More

  3. Click Start or Revisit next to the ACA

  4. As you walk through the questions, you will be asked if you received a 1095-A. 

  5. If you did NOT, click YES anyway.

  6. Enter 0's for the Marketplace identifier and Policy number.

  7. Enter $1 for January monthly premium amount and SLCSP

  8. Walkthrough to the end and submit your return."
